Quick Summary
The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) Omaha District is soliciting proposals for Janitorial Services at the Fort Peck Power Plant in Fort Peck, Montana. This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side opportunity for a Firm Fixed-Price contract covering a base year and four option years. Offers are due by March 25, 2026, at 2:00 PM CT.
Scope of Work
The contractor will provide non-personnel janitorial services, including all necessary labor, supervision, cleaning materials, supplies, and equipment. Services encompass sweeping, vacuuming, dusting, mopping, scrubbing, waxing, polishing, washing, cleaning, disinfecting, trash collection, waste removal, replenishing supplies (paper towels, deodorizers, soap), and snow removal. Services are to be performed in accordance with the Performance Work Statement (PWS) and detailed task schedules (daily, weekly, monthly, quarterly, semi-annual) across various areas of Power Plant 1, Power Plant 1 Museum, Shaft Spillway, and Power Plant 2.
Contract & Timeline
- Contract Type: Firm Fixed Price
- Duration: One (1) Base Year (April 1, 2026 - March 31, 2027) and four (4) 12-month Option Years.
- Set-Aside: Total Small Business Set-Aside (FAR 19.5)
- NAICS Code: 561720 (Cleaning Services) with a $22,000,000 size standard.
- Questions Due: March 18, 2026, by 12:00 PM CST.
- Site Visit: A mandatory site visit was held on March 18, 2026, at 0800 AM MT. Offerors were urged to inspect the site.
- Offer Due Date: March 25, 2026, by 2:00 PM CT.
- Published Date: March 18, 2026 (latest update).
Evaluation
Proposals will be evaluated based on Technical (Work Plan), Past Performance, and Price. Technical and Past Performance are considered more important than Price. The Government intends to award without discussions. Offerors must hold prices firm for 60 calendar days.
